Think Drums is designed to be a percussion communication center filled with helpful hints on related arts, drumming and percussion music education. Students can download free music files, rudiment sheets, and music tools to improve their percussion skills... and just have fun!

ThinkDrums.com provides music students with information about private drum lessons, semi-private drum lessons, group drumline instruction, percussion clinics, drum set lessons, drumline improvement and percussion master classes available in the Greenville, Anderson, Union and Taylors, South Carolina area. Think Drums not only helps drumming in Upstate South Carolina, but all over the Country through online pod casts, virtual drum lessons, and personal motivational coaching.

Think Drums curricula highlights the unlimited possibilities that attitudes and the arts can foster.

Bucket Bash at Fraction Reaction by Think Drums

Students Perform at Greenville County's Gifted Center

Several private drum lesson students performed at Sterling School's Charles Townes Center on Monday June 2. Charles Townes Center, formerly Greenville County Gifted Center, hosted Think Drums' Fraction ReAction. The Students performed Bucket Bash for all fourth grade students and one third grade class.

The 3rd and 4th grade students were extremely attentive and enthusiastically participated in interactive percussion oriented math drills.

Fraction ReAction is a proprietary percussion music education program designed to make math and fractions more fun. The young percussionists also assisted Mr. Irish with math themed rudiments, exercises, and drum stick tricks. The finale featured a novelty percussion piece entitled "Bucket Bash" played on real five gallon buckets.


Bucket Bash was written by both Mr. Irish and his students as way to study music composition and improvisation. The presentation also gives the private lesson students a chance to perform in front of a live audience. Later that day, the group performed for a Southside High School music class.
